The Lodge 6 Quart Enameled Cast Iron Dutch Oven is a versatile and attractive kitchen essential. With a generous capacity of 6 quarts (5.6 liters), it’s perfect for preparing family meals like stews, roasts, or even baking bread. Its round shape allows for even cooking, while the dual handles provide a sturdy grip for transferring from stovetop to oven or table. This Dutch oven can withstand temperatures up to 500°F, making it suitable for various cooking methods such as broiling, braising, and baking.
One of the standout features is its porcelain enamel coating, which not only enhances its aesthetic appeal in a vibrant Island Spice Red but also makes for easy cleaning and minimal sticking. While it is dishwasher safe, hand washing is recommended to maintain its finish. The cast iron construction ensures excellent heat retention and distribution, which means your meals cook evenly and stay warm longer.
There are some considerations to keep in mind. Weighing nearly 15 pounds, this Dutch oven can be heavy, especially when full, which might be a concern for some users. Additionally, while the enamel coating helps prevent rust, it can chip if not handled carefully, so it’s best to avoid using metal utensils.
The Tramontina Tri-Ply Clad Stainless Steel 6-Quart Braiser Pan offers a spacious 6-quart capacity, making it suitable for braising, slow cooking, and searing large portions, which is great for family meals or gatherings. The tri-ply clad construction with an aluminum core ensures even heat distribution and precise cooking control, a notable strength for those who value consistent cooking results.
Its versatility is impressive, being compatible with various cooktops, including gas, electric, induction, and ceramic glass, and it is oven safe up to 350°F. Cleaning is made easy as it is dishwasher-safe. The transparent glass lid is a practical feature that allows monitoring without losing moisture and flavor, while the ergonomic stainless steel handles provide a comfortable and secure grip.
At 7.8 pounds, it might be relatively heavy for some users to handle, especially when filled with food. The polished stainless steel finish is durable and backed by NSF certification and a lifetime warranty, which speaks to its quality and longevity. While it is not a traditional cast-iron braiser, it stands out in terms of modern convenience and multi-functionality, making it a good choice for those who need a versatile and reliable pan for everyday cooking.
The Le Creuset Enameled Cast Iron Signature Braiser in Cerise stands out in the cast iron braiser category due to its exceptional heat distribution and retention, making it ideal for slow-cooking, braising, or even baking. With a capacity of 3.5 quarts, it’s a suitable size for preparing meals for small to medium families or gatherings. The enameled surface is a major plus, as it eliminates the need for seasoning, and the light-colored interior makes it easy to monitor the cooking process without lifting the lid.
One of the braiser's strengths is its lightweight design, being one of the lightest cast iron options available, which makes it easier to handle, especially when filled with food. The ergonomic handles and stainless steel knob are well-designed for safe lifting, even at high oven temperatures. Additionally, the tight-fitting glass lid is effective at trapping moisture, enhancing the tenderness of your dishes.
While the enamel coating is durable, it can chip if not handled with care, which might be a concern for some users. This piece comes at a premium price, which may not fit every budget, but the quality and performance justify it for many users. Even though it is dishwasher safe, hand washing is recommended to maintain its appearance and longevity.
